librenms/librenms

View on GitHub
mibs/ict/ICT-DIGITAL-SERIES-MIB

Summary

Maintainability
Test Coverage
-- ICT MIB file for ICT Digital Series.
--
-- Date        Version
-- =============================
-- 10/4/12    v1.00
--
--  Renamed from ICT-MIB to ICT-DIGITAL-SERIES-MIB

ICT-DIGITAL-SERIES-MIB DEFINITIONS ::= BEGIN

IMPORTS
    enterprises, IpAddress    FROM RFC1155-SMI
    DisplayString        FROM RFC1213-MIB
    OBJECT-TYPE        FROM RFC-1212
    TRAP-TYPE        FROM RFC-1215;

ictPower            OBJECT IDENTIFIER ::= { enterprises 39145 }

digitalSeries            OBJECT IDENTIFIER ::= { ictPower 11 }

deviceModel            OBJECT-TYPE
    SYNTAX            DisplayString
    ACCESS            read-only
    STATUS            mandatory
    DESCRIPTION        "Model Number"
    ::= { digitalSeries 1 }

deviceName            OBJECT-TYPE
    SYNTAX            DisplayString
    ACCESS            read-only
    STATUS            mandatory
    DESCRIPTION        "Device Name"
    ::= { digitalSeries 2 }

deviceHardware            OBJECT-TYPE
    SYNTAX            INTEGER (0..127)
    ACCESS            read-only
    STATUS            mandatory
    DESCRIPTION        "Hardware Version"
    ::= { digitalSeries 3 }

deviceFirmware            OBJECT-TYPE
    SYNTAX            DisplayString
    ACCESS            read-only
    STATUS            mandatory
    DESCRIPTION        "Firmware Version"
    ::= { digitalSeries 4 }

deviceMacAddress        OBJECT-TYPE
    SYNTAX            DisplayString
    ACCESS            read-only
    STATUS            mandatory
    DESCRIPTION        "MAC Address"
    ::= { digitalSeries 5 }

inputVoltage            OBJECT-TYPE
    SYNTAX            DisplayString
    ACCESS            read-only
    STATUS            mandatory
    DESCRIPTION        "Input Voltage (VAC)"
    ::= { digitalSeries 6 }

outputVoltage            OBJECT-TYPE
    SYNTAX            DisplayString
    ACCESS            read-only
    STATUS            mandatory
    DESCRIPTION        "Output Voltage (VDC)"
    ::= { digitalSeries 7 }

outputCurrent            OBJECT-TYPE
    SYNTAX            DisplayString
    ACCESS            read-only
    STATUS            mandatory
    DESCRIPTION        "System Current (Amps)"
    ::= { digitalSeries 8 }

outputEnable            OBJECT-TYPE
    SYNTAX            INTEGER { ENABLED(1), DISABLED(2) }
    ACCESS            read-only
    STATUS            mandatory
    DESCRIPTION        "Output Enable Status (a value of 1 indicates Output is Enabled, and a value of 2 indicates Output is Disabled)"
    ::= { digitalSeries 9 }


END